I'm 6'1 with long legs, I find it a snug fit for legroom but there's ample head room so as you're taller but long int he torso it'll probably work out fine.

For legroom you can remove the tray under the steering column where the service book id and also remove the console if you want more width for your knees. If you're test driving remember the steering wheel telescopes (although it doeasn't tilt) which can help accomodate your knees if needed.

All in all I find my car very comfortable but there's no substitute for trying one out. I wasn't at all comfortable in a Miata I sat in.
